Abstract
Case handling systems offer a solution to the lack of flexibility and adaptability in workflow management systems. Because they are data driven they potentially provide good support for Product Based Workflow Design (PBWD). In this paper we investigate to which degree current case handling systems (FLOWer and Activity Manager) are able to support PBWD. This is done by elaborating the design process of a case from industry in both systems. From this evaluation we concluded that current case handling systems are not yet completely ready for supporting PBWD. Therefore, we recognize that better tool support is needed to make PBWD more suitable for practical use.
